Coping Skills for Adolescents

This group will be comprised of teens that struggle with anger management, decision making, peer pressure, and family relationship issues. The focus will be to assist teens in acquiring appropriate coping skills that they can use in their daily functioning. The group may require that parents or guardians attend selected sessions. Coping Skills for Adults
This group will deal with various issues that are complicated by a lack of coping skills. Whether the issue is anger management, codependency, depression, or trauma disorder, learning coping skills is the key to dealing with the most difficult issues and disorders. This group is designed to assist members in learning to manage their symptoms by utilizing a myriad of techniques and skills that you will learn in the group.
